Estimated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$3,500 - $7,500 (lar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Pavement Leveling for Driveways |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Sidewalk Repair | $2,000 - $4,500 |
| Parking Lot Leveling | $4,000 - $7,500 |
| Street Surface Adjustment | $3,500 - $6,500 |
| Crack Filling and Surface Smoothing | $1,500 - $3,000 |
| Subgrade Stabilization | $5,000 - $12,000 |

Pavement leveling in Burke, VA, involves correcting uneven or sunken surfaces to restore a smooth, safe driving and walking area. This process is suitable for driveways, sidewalks, and parking lots that have experienced settling or minor damage over time. Understanding typical project components can help in comparing options and estimating costs for pavement leveling services.
- Materials: Commonly involves asphalt, concrete, or base materials tailored to existing pavement types and conditions.
- Size and Scope: Ranges from small sidewalk sections to large driveway areas, with scope influencing overall effort and cost.
- Labor Complexity: Generally straightforward but may vary depending on pavement condition and underlying issues.
- Permitting: Usually requires local permits in Burke, VA, especially for larger or structural work.
- Extras: Additional services might include crack filling, surface sealing, or minor repairs to enhance longevity and appearance.
